today we explore the streets of an abandoned neighborhood left behind from the Great Flood of 2019 . The first location : a1970s-era community with many signs of former residents still remaining, with multiple streets of trailers that still contain furniture, personal belongings, and everyday items left behind. Vehicles are also scattered throughout the area, that were never moved after the evacuation, suggesting people left quickly and never returned. In addition to the trailers, there are several A-frame vacation homes that are still standing but show clear signs of age, water damage, and long-term neglect. Equipped with Spiral Staircases, wood paneling, it was once a popular destination in the 1970s, but now, also abandoned.
